What is a vanadium flow battery?

Open access Abstract Vanadium Flow Batteries (VFBs) are a stationary energy storage technology, that can play a pivotal role in the integration of renewable sources into the electrical grid, thanks to unique advantages like power and energy independent sizing, no risk of explosion or fire and extremely long operating life.

What oxidation state does vanadium have?

It exploits the ability of vanadium to exist in four different oxidation states: a tank stores the negative electrolyte (anolyte or negolyte) containing V(II) (bivalent V2+) and V(III) (trivalent V3+), while the other tank stores the positive electrolyte (catholyte or posolyte) containing V(IV) (tetravalent VO2+) and V(V) (pentavalent VO2+).
